#286358 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#286358 is composed of 15.7% red, 38.8%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.1% yellow and 61.2% black. It has a hue angle of 168.8 degrees, a saturation of 42.4% and a lightness of 27.3%. #286358 color hex could be obtained by blending #50c6b0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#286358 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#286358 has RGB values of R:40, G:99,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0, Y:0.11,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 2646872.
